Italian pig iron to soar again
Italian pig iron prices are seen increasing next week to $570/tonne (€473) cfr Italy. Some sources however believe that offers from the CIS region may be pushed up to $575-580/t cfr as new sales to distributors are expected.
The increase is in line with soaring international prices and limited pig iron availability. A Turkish buyer was recently heard to have purchased CIS pig iron at $565/t cfr Turkey.
